Background Story: Ryan's heart pounded and adrenaline pumped furiously through his body, however this was nothing new. He walked steadily through the coridoors of the sprawling Undercity, cloaked from head to toe to hide the fact that he wasn't actually dead. This wasn't the first time he walked this path to his contact within the city. He always enjoyed this city for its ease of hiding, no one bothered you unless you bothered them, but something seemed off this time his path was too empty.
He arrived at the smallest book shop in the magic quater and set several hundred gold peices on the counter.
"A copy of The Betrayer Ascendant if you have it." He left hand fell to his daggers on his belt and he gripped them tightly.
"Heh, Haven't you read that one before?"
"Yes but my copy seems to be out of date."
"Ah, out of date. Yes that seems to be common in this world today." He swept the coins off the counter and deposited them in his pocket and waved Ryan to follow. "Come with me I think I have the latest one in the back."
The shopkeep closed the door behind them and Ryan took off his hood. "It is good to see you again old friend."
"Always for the son of Silvered Martha." His expession changed slightly but since his face was now half gone Ryan always had trouble guessing what the old forsaken was thinking. "I came across these," he pulled down three scrolls from nearby shelves and handed them to Ryan.
"Plentiful as always." Ryan started to unseal the scroll when the Shopkeep set his hand on Ryan's to stop him.
"I am sorry, but I can't die again," and he pointed the back door.
Ignoring his hood, Ryan shoved the scrolls in his bag and bounded to the door shoving the shopkeeper to the floor as the door to the shop was broken open and Forsaken guards rushed in. Ryan droped several black balls that exploded behind him in a cloud of thick smoke.
He ran quickly following one of the paths he knew of to the surface. Several guards blocked his path but before they saw him two of them fell with daggers protruding from their chests. The others reached for their swords but he was already upon them. He landed a solid kick the the first that sent him falling into the wall. A few quick jabs and he disarmed the second, twisted and shoved a third dagger into it's chin and up to the brain. He drew it out and flung it into the last guard's head as it was stumbling up. They both fell with loud thumps to the ground. "THIS WAY I HEARD SOME FIGHTING!" Ryan cursed under his breath and pulled his first two daggers out of the guards and sprinted down his path. At least he didn't tell them which path I would take. The rest of his path was empty but at the trap door to the empty streets above he set a trap just in case.
He climbed to the southern wall of Lordaeron and pulled out a flare gun, hope they sent the gryphon already. He shot it off towards the lake and after a few minutes a lone gryphon flew towards him and landed. As he got on a few streets over he heard a cry of pain and saw green whispers of smoke rising. Ryan grinned and squeezed his heels to the gryphon's sides and said, "Lets fly to home." He soared off towards Aerie Peak.
He aimed high in the sky and pulled his hood up and tighten his cloak around him as the air thinned and dropped to freezing temperatures. After a few hours the city of the Wildhammer dwarfs came into sight. He landed and greeted the flightmaster, "Glad ter see ya brought this one back unharmed." Ryan hopped down and pulled off his hood. "Hey that last one wasn't my fault," he grinned and patted the old flightmaster on the back.
He walked down to the inn and found a table in the back and pulled out the scrolls. He rolled them out and set to reading them. I wonder just how far back him and my mom went. Everything is actually here. Standard troop movements and locations of new supply lines. He got to the last scroll and it was comprised of the shopkeepers own handwriting.
I have no doubt that you are reading this safely in some Inn far from horde soldiers by now. I hope that you did not suffer much from my unfortunate but necessary betrayal. Do not worry I am safe, I learned more than just haggling from your mother, but I must warn you not to come back to Undercity for quiet some time and to no longer count me as a contact. They will be watching me from now on.
Originally I planned to sell this next bit for as much as you had but given that I was betrayed by my last assistant and then in turn had to betray you, I'm giving you this bit of information for free in hopes to make me square with you and your mother.
A group loyal to Grand Apothecary Putress and intent on avenging his death has sprung up recently here in Undercity with a new plan. From what I have heard they plan to steal and use this new plague against King Varian and the new Warchief Garrosh. Unfortunately I was not able to find out how they plan to get the plague to them. I found several Alliance and Horde order forms for several different produce, but there were still more I didn't see. I would suggest you start there. Lastly their leader's name is Johnathan Cook and the call themselves The Forsook.
